How this works
  1. 1
    Add colour stops

    Click the bar to add stops. Drag them left/right to change where colours transition.

  2. 2
    Angle & type

    Switch between linear, radial and conic. Set the angle so it flows the way you want.

  3. 3
    Copy the CSS

    Grab the background: linear-gradient(...) line and paste it in.
